安装mysql服务器;mysql服务器怎么安装

安装mysql服务器;mysql服务器怎么安装

在安装MySQL服务器之前,需要进行一些准备工作。确保你的操作系统符合MySQL的系统要求。下载适合你操作系统的MySQL安装包,并将其保存在合适的位置。备份你的数据,以防安装过程中出现意外情况。

2. 安装MySQL服务器

安装MySQL服务器有多种方法,你可以选择使用图形化界面安装程序或者命令行安装。下面以命令行安装为例进行介绍。

打开终端或命令提示符,并进入到你保存MySQL安装包的目录。然后,解压安装包并进入解压后的目录。

接下来,执行安装命令。在Linux系统中,可以使用以下命令安装MySQL服务器:

sudo ./configure

sudo make

sudo make install

在Windows系统中,可以运行安装程序并按照提示进行安装。

3. 配置MySQL服务器

安装完成后,需要对MySQL服务器进行一些配置。进入MySQL安装目录,并找到my.cnf文件。该文件包含了MySQL服务器的配置信息。

打开my.cnf文件,并根据你的需求进行配置。你可以设置MySQL服务器的端口号、字符集、缓冲区大小等参数。配置完成后,保存文件并退出。

接下来,启动MySQL服务器。在Linux系统中,可以使用以下命令启动MySQL服务器:

sudo service mysql start

在Windows系统中,可以在服务管理器中启动MySQL服务。

4. 连接MySQL服务器

安装和配置MySQL服务器后,可以使用MySQL客户端工具连接到服务器。MySQL提供了多种客户端工具,如命令行客户端、图形化界面客户端等。

使用命令行客户端连接MySQL服务器,可以在终端或命令提示符中输入以下命令:

mysql -h 主机名 -u 用户名 -p

其中,主机名是MySQL服务器所在的主机名或IP地址,用户名是连接MySQL服务器的用户名,-p选项表示需要输入密码。

输入密码后,如果连接成功,你将看到MySQL的命令行提示符。

5. 创建和管理数据库

连接到MySQL服务器后,可以使用MySQL命令创建和管理数据库。以下是一些常用的命令:

– 创建数据库:`CREATE DATABASE 数据库名;`

– 删除数据库:`DROP DATABASE 数据库名;`

– 切换到数据库:`USE 数据库名;`

– 查看当前数据库:`SELECT DATABASE();`

还可以使用命令创建和管理表、插入和查询数据等。

6. 安全性配置

为了保护MySQL服务器的安全性,需要进行一些安全性配置。以下是一些常用的安全性配置方法:

– 修改默认管理员密码:使用以下命令修改默认管理员密码:

“`

ALTER USER ‘root’@’localhost’ IDENTIFIED BY ‘新密码’;

“`

– 创建新的管理员用户:使用以下命令创建新的管理员用户:

“`

CREATE USER ‘用户名’@’localhost’ IDENTIFIED BY ‘密码’;

GRANT ALL PRIVILEGES ON *.* TO ‘用户名’@’localhost’ WITH GRANT OPTION;

“`

– 配置防火墙:使用防火墙软件限制对MySQL服务器的访问。

7. 监控和优化MySQL服务器

为了确保MySQL服务器的性能和稳定性,可以进行监控和优化。以下是一些常用的监控和优化方法:

– 使用MySQL自带的性能监控工具:MySQL提供了多个性能监控工具,如mysqladmin、mysqlslap等,可以使用这些工具监控MySQL服务器的性能指标。

– 配置缓冲区和连接数:根据服务器的硬件和负载情况,适当调整MySQL服务器的缓冲区和连接数,以提高性能。

– 优化查询语句:通过优化查询语句,可以减少数据库查询的时间和资源消耗。

8. 升级和维护MySQL服务器

定期升级和维护MySQL服务器是保持服务器性能和安全性的重要步骤。以下是一些常用的升级和维护方法:

– 检查并应用的安全补丁:定期检查MySQL的安全补丁,并及时应用以保护服务器的安全性。

– 备份和恢复数据:定期备份数据库,并测试备份的可用性,以防止数据丢失。

– 清理和优化数据库:定期清理无用的数据和索引,并进行数据库优化,以提高性能。

安装MySQL服务器需要进行准备工作,然后按照指导进行安装和配置。连接到服务器后,可以创建和管理数据库,并进行安全性配置。为了保证服务器的性能和安全性,可以进行监控和优化。定期升级和维护MySQL服务器,以保持其性能和安全性。

Image

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/69439.html<

(0)
运维的头像运维
上一篇2025-02-06 23:27
下一篇 2025-02-06 23:29

相关推荐

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注